Galle Face Green Worlds Tallest Christmas Tree Project Stopped Suddenly Due to Protests by the Catholic Church.

By Norman Palihawadana

Chairman of the committee which was entrusted the work on the giant Christmas tree which was being constructed at the Galle Face Green, Mangala P.Gunasekera yesterday said the project was called off and its objective was religious harmony.

Addressing a news conference at the Ports and Shipping Ministry auditorium Gunasekera said the giant Christmas project had been a major attraction to many people including foreigners, who were planning to visit Sri Lanka and the occupancy rates of star class hotels had further increased.

But, in the end the hopes of all those had been dashed, he said.

Gunasekera said due to objections from the Catholic Church, the committee decided to call off the project.

He denied any official involvement of the Ports and Shipping Ministry with the project though a few employees of the ministry had a hand in it.

If the giant Christmas tree had been completed it would have been a world record, he said.

“Although the project had the blessings of the Catholic clergy the organisers had not obtained the permission of the Catholic Church.” Gunasekera said.

A tearful E.S. Nanayakkara the creator of the Christmas tree said. “All our hopes were dashed after millions of rupees had been spent on the project.”
